What's Happening?
ESPN analyst Ben Solak has highlighted former Clemson defensive tackle Ruke Orhorhoro as a player poised for a breakout season. After being drafted by the Atlanta Falcons and experiencing limited playing time, Orhorhoro was traded to the Jacksonville
Jaguars. Solak believes that the Jaguars' defensive setup, with a thin front seven, provides Orhorhoro the opportunity to shine. With only a few players ahead of him on the depth chart, Orhorhoro is expected to play a more significant role, potentially becoming a key player for the Jaguars.
